The MITRE CVE dictionary describes this issue as:

Multiple buffer overflows in the dtt_load function in loaders/dtt_load.c Extended Module Player (XMP) 2.5.1 and earlier all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via unspecified vectors related to an untrusted length value and the (1) pofs and (2) plen arrays.
